Modafinil Features

Modafinil dubbed a “smart drug” is a nootropic that has been around for over 40 years. It was first discovered as a narcolepsy drug by a French scientist working at Lafon Laboratories in the 1970s. In 1998, the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approved it under the brand name Provigil for use in the treatment of narcolepsy and in 2003 for shift work sleep disorder (SWSD) and obstructive sleep apnea (OSA). Aside from its approved indications, modafinil is also used off-label by doctors to treat other health conditions, including att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), cancer-related fatigue, and multiple sclerosis fatigue. It is also considered an effective drug for depression and cocaine dependence [1].

Modafinil is a stimulant that works by increasing the levels of certain chemicals in the brain, including dopamine, orexin, norepinephrine, and histamine. This leads to increased wakefulness, enhanced alertness, and boosted productivity. It also augments cognitive abilities, including memory, focus, and mental acuity. Modafinil is also popularly known for its mood-brightening effects. Healthy individuals such as students, scientists, business executives, coders, and airline pilots use the “smart drug” off-label to ameliorate attention, concentration, decision-making & planning skills, reasoning, and learning.

Today, apart from the branded version, modafinil is available as a generic medication due to patent expiration and is sold under various brand names, including Alertec and Modavigil [2].
